The Municipality of Port Hope provides financial support to non-profit organizations and registered charities through our annual community grant program. If you are requesting a smaller amount, you will need to apply for a donation.

Community Grants eligibility requirements and guidelines

Review the eligibility requirements below and learn how to apply before you begin your application.

Eligibility

Community grants support non-profit volunteer community organizations and registered charities.

To be considered, your organization must:

  • Initiate or deliver programs and services to the citizens of Port Hope;
  • Provide events of Municipal, Provincial or National significance, which could be expected to bring economic, and/or public relations benefit to the Municipality;
  • Provide programs and services to address any urgent and pressing events and natural disasters (i.e., fire, flood, earthquake);
  • Initiate programs or services for individuals, groups or teams who require assistance to participate in recognized regional, provincial, national or international championships; and
  • Organizations must be either a non-profit organization or a registered charity.

In order to receive the grant, your organization must request funds for:

  • General operating and capital expenses including administrative costs and program-related expenses;
  • Activities/functions generally occurring within the Municipality of Port Hope boundaries; and
  • Programs/activities/functions addressing a community need, responding to an underserviced demand or contributing to the positive image of the Municipality.

Requirements

Each organization submitting an application is required to provide:
  •  Information about the organization and its programs or services;
  • A statement of the organization’s goals and objectives;
  • A description of how the organization’s program or service advances Council’s strategic plan;
  • A description of how the organization intends to measure the success of the program or service if the funding request is approved;
  • Demonstrated need for financial assistance;
  • Which stream of funding the organization is applying to as the program will be administered in two streams: up to $5,000 or up to $10,000, and applicants will no longer be specifying a requested grant amount;
  • There is community support for the programs or services;
  • Adequate funding for the programs or services is not available from other sources;
  • It is presently exploring, or has fully explored, the potential funding from other sources, from other levels of government, the private sector, memberships, donations, and fundraising activities;
  • Efforts have been made to decrease reliance on Municipal funding so other emerging needs or opportunities may be met; and
  • If a grant was received in the preceding year, the Municipalities financial support was acknowledged in all information pertaining to activities for which funds were granted per the policy.

Restrictions

The following restrictions apply:
  • Organizations can only submit one community grant application per year;
  • If the programs or services proposed in the organization’s application are not commenced or not completed within the current fiscal year and there remain Municipality’s funds on hand, or are completed without requiring the full use of the Municipality funds, such Municipality funds will be returned to the Municipality;
  • The granting of assistance in any year is not to be considered a commitment to providing grant funding assistance in future years; and
  • Funding is provided only for the sole purpose for which it was awarded within the current fiscal year.
The Community Grant program isn't intended to provide funding:
  •  On a retroactive basis for events that have already occurred;
  • To coalitions such as ratepayer or tenant/landlord associations, or to support programs or services geared specifically to these organizations;
  • To organizations aligned with any political party, or to support programs or services which are political in nature;
  • To support programs or services which are operated under the authority of another level of government, such as social services;
  • As donations to charitable causes;
  • As a replacement for other funding sources;
  • For debt retirement; or
  • To an applicant that has an overdue amount owing to the Municipality of Port Hope.

Application guidelines

Staff will provide the applications to Finance Committee for their review. Finance Committee will review and determine successful applicants. Finance Committee will use the application requirements as conditions when screening each application to distinguish whether the application meets the requirements set out in the Community Grant Policy and should be considered for funding. Finance Committee will determine the community grant budget amount for each stream and how this budget amount is to be divided across successful applicants.

Please ensure your application has met these guidelines before submitting: 

  1.  All applicants must read the Community Grant Policy before completing their organization’s community grant application form and financial information (see below for options to submit either online or by hard copy)
  2. Responses are required to be provided for all the application questions. Staff are only required to provide Finance Committee application forms completed in full, meeting all application requirements, and legible for the Committee’s consideration each year.
  3. Applications must be submitted to the Finance Department no later than Wednesday September 25, 2024 by 4:30 p.m., as shown on the time stamp in the Municipal Office. Applications can be submitted online or as a hard copy. You can mail or drop off hard copy documents at Town Hall 56 Queen Street Port Hope Ontario L1A 3Z9. Please note that applications submitted through mail must be received by the Municipality by the deadline as outlined.

 Application submission checklist 

  • I have read the Community Grant Policy
  • I have completed Community Grant Application with full answers for all questions (either online or by hard copy)
  • I have collected the required signature for the Signed Attestation as part of the Community Grant Application

Late submissions

Applications received on the due date, are considered on time. Any applications received after the due date will be considered late.

Please note that complete applications that are late may be considered for the grant at the discretion of the Finance Committee. Late submissions that are incomplete will not be considered.

Review process for community grant applications
Once your application has been submitted, we will review the community grant applications as per the below process. 
 Provide applications to Finance Committee
We will provide the applications to Finance Committee for their review. Finance Committee will use the application requirements as conditions when screening each application to distinguish whether the application meets the requirements and should be considered for funding. 
 Notify applicant that application will be considered
We will notify you in advance of the scheduled meeting date that your application will be considered by the Finance Committee. The Finance Committee may request that you appear as a delegation to speak on behalf of your application.
 Award grant
We will notify you if you are awarded a community grant following final Council approval of the annual budget.
After receiving a grant
Your organization must acknowledge the support of the Municipality of Port Hope in all advertising, publicity, programs, and signage for all events and programs related to the grant. You may not represent the Municipality of Port Hope as a partner or hold the Municipality responsible for any obligations relating to the grant initiative.
